Job Description

The candidate will:

  • Take overall responsibility for the operation and maintenance of the Electron Microscopy Facility in MSE. This facility includes an aberration-corrected scanning TEM (JEOL ARM200 STEM), a JEOL 2800 TEM, two dual-beam focused ion beams (FIBs) and associated equipment such as dedicated specimen holders, sample preparation facilities, and computer hardware.
  • Provide user training and occasionally support to ad-hoc requests for the operation of the TEM, STEM and FIBs.
  • Ensure smooth operation of the facilities by planning maintenance and repair work in advance, by liaising with the instrument manufacturers and the building maintenance team.
  • Be the first point of contact of the Electron Microscopy Facility, both for the users, and towards the instrument manufacturers.
  • Be willing to occasionally fulfil duties after office hours: as the first point of contact in case of calamities in the lab.
  • Be responsible for keeping the documentation of the standard operation procedures up-to-date.
  • Ensure the safety of the labs is in good order and keep the safety documents of the facility up to date.
  • Assist on lab tours when there are visitors and outreach events.
Qualifications
  • MSc or PhD degree.
  • A minimum of 4 years of relevant experience is required in using and/or managing electron microscopes.
  • The candidate must have a responsible attitude towards the smooth operation of the facility and be able to interact easily with various users and equipment vendors.
  • The candidate must be capable of performing (or willing to learn) atomic-resolution STEM imaging, and high-quality electron spectroscopy, including data processing and the sharing of these results with the ad-hoc users.
